Gross domestic product per capita, PPP, (constant 2021 international) in Republic of Moldova
Republic of Moldova: Gross domestic product per capita, PPP, (constant 2021 international) was 16,377 Int$/cap in 2024. ▲ Rising
Gross domestic product per capita, PPP, (constant 2021 international) in Republic of Moldova, 2000–2024
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in Int$/cap.
Analysis
The most recent figure for gross domestic product per capita, ppp, (constant 2021 international) in Republic of Moldova is 16,377 Int$/cap, measured in 2024. That is the highest value across all 25 years on record.
The figure is up 2.4% on the previous year and up 40.7% over ten years.
Over the whole period, gross domestic product per capita, ppp, (constant 2021 international) in Republic of Moldova peaked at 16,377 Int$/cap in 2024 and was at its lowest, 5,727 Int$/cap, in 2000.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 25 years of available data.

About this data
The Suite of Food Security Indicators presents the core set of food security indicators. Following the recommendation of experts gathered in the Committee on World Food Security (CFS) Round Table on hunger measurement, hosted at FAO headquarters in September 2011, an initial set of indicators aiming to capture various aspects of food insecurity is presented here. The choice of the indicators has been informed by expert judgement and the availability of data with sufficient coverage to enable comparisons across regions and over time. Many of these indicators are produced and published elsewhere by FAO and other international organizations. They are reported here in a single database with the aim of building a wide food security information system. More indicators will be added to this set as more data will become available. Indicators are classified along the four dimensions of food security -- availability, access, utilization and stability.
